6 of the best exchanges for buying altcoins

So you've got a few major cryptocurrencies like Bitcoin and Ethereum, but now you want to see what the broader cryptocurrency world has to offer. You want to buy altcoins.

An altcoin is any cryptocurrency that is not Bitcoin (an alternative coin to Bitcoin). This means that thousands of altcoins are waiting for your attention.

Want to check it out? Here are six of the best altcoin exchanges.

1. Binance

Perhaps you were expecting to see some left-handed exchange with a bunch of altcoins)? No, the best altcoin exchanges are often the most famous. At the same time, Binance offers more 500 pairs of coins at the time of writing, making it one of the most populous altcoin exchanges of them all. It is important for users that Binance has a large trading volume and a very good security history.

Binance also has a rich history of introducing new altcoins. Binance LaunchPad helps filter out the best new altcoin projects ( known as Initial Exchange Offerings ), giving them the opportunity to grow and exposing them to a huge audience on the main trading site.

 

2. HitBTC

HitBTC is another major exchange with high trading volume. He regularly reaches 500 million per day. The exchange offers a huge number of trading pairs: more 750 at the time of writing.

The number of pairs places HitBTC among the largest altcoin exchanges. The YoBit exchange is probably number one (with a pair of over 4000 coins), but has a very negative reputation.

A huge number of pairs means that anyone who wants to buy altcoins has a good chance of finding what he wants.

Like any cryptocurrency exchange, HitBTC has its share of negative reviews. We recommend trading small volumes on HitBTC just to be on the safe side.

3. IDEX

IDEX is a decentralized Ethereum asset exchange and another great exchange to buy altcoins.

The exchange focuses on trading ERC-20 peer-to-peer tokens, regularly raking in over $ 500 million in 24-hour trading volume. At the time of writing, IDEX offers over 500 trading pairs Focusing exclusively on Ethereum-based tokens.

IDEX is popular for a variety of reasons. On the one hand, it is decentralized, providing additional security for users through peer-to-peer transactions. Indeed, IDEX ranks on our list of the best decentralized exchanges.

In addition, it has very low GAS costs, minimizing transaction fees, and also offers many market analysis and charting tools.

4. Bittrex

I used Bittrex for a very long time until I switched to Binance to take advantage of Launchpad and Initial Exchange.

But Bittrex remains a popular exchange, even if its total trading volume has declined recently. However, on a positive note for Bittrex, the number of trading pairs available to users is over 350 at the time of writing.

Like Binance, Bittrex also has a cryptocurrency launcher. Bittrex's initial exchange offerings started off badly and, in truth, don't have a better reputation. But the site itself is still one of the safest and therefore one of the best altcoin exchanges.

5. OKEx

OKEx is a Malta-based altcoin exchange with more than 400 pairs of coins .

It regularly appears on the list of the best cryptocurrency exchanges, and it's easy to see why. A friendly user interface, minimal fuss about cashing out or exchanging, and a solid security history keep OKEx at the top of the altcoin exchange rankings.

OKEx regularly sees 500 million dollars per 24-hour trading volume, which is a big plus for altcoin traders who need liquidity.

But it's not just altcoins that keep OKEx in the news about cryptocurrency. The exchange is also trying to create a globalized standard that all cryptocurrency exchanges must follow, similar to the World Federation of Exchanges.

“Cryptocurrencies are global and decentralized and the industry remains nascent, so regulations are not enough. The only way for exchanges to grow and make an impact is to come together to develop practices and policies that set the global standard and adapt to regional regulatory frameworks.”

Andy Chung, OKEx Operations Manager

6. p2pb2b

Our list concludes with the fastest growing altcoin exchange in the world, p2pb2b.

Like most of the other altcoin exchanges on this list, p2pb2b regularly has 24-hour trading volume in excess of $ 500 million. It lists more than 450 pairs of coins .

She also receives reliable user reviews from various sources and regularly lists new altcoins for her users.

p2pb2b also has a convenient mobile application that allows you to view altcoins on the go (and also hold them on top of bags with altcoins!).

Although p2pb2b has a large volume and a large number of coin pairs, it is also a relatively new altcoin exchange. Due to this, we advise you to be careful before placing large amounts of cryptocurrency.

What is the best Altcoin exchange?

For us, the best altcoin exchange is anyone who takes your security seriously.

First of all, you need to be sure that your cryptocurrency is safe. Remember that until you move the cryptocurrency from the exchange to your personal wallet, you are not 100% protected.

Second, it depends on what kind of altcoin you want to buy. Some altcoin exchanges only list a small number of tokens, so you might not find the altcoin you want.

However, the best practice is to stick with those who have a solid reputation.
